Subject: Partitioning cut-over complete

Team — the Ledgerline orders table is now partitioned by month. Cut-over ran Saturday 02:00–04:40, no data loss. Queries spanning more than six months may be slower until stats rebuild finishes tonight. Old monolithic table is renamed, not dropped; we keep it two weeks. Route any slow-query tickets to the Veridon data desk. Current settings for the partition manager are listed below.

settings of tagef-bawif:
DRUIX_HOST=druix.zemvarlabs.internal
DRUIX_PORT=8000

## Runbook: Replica Lag Alarm

When the Tarnwick read-replica lag alarm fires, first confirm the lag metric on the database dashboard exceeds 90 seconds for five consecutive minutes. If a release is in progress, pause the rollout and drain long-running analytics queries. Do not fail over unless lag exceeds ten minutes and is still climbing. After mitigation, redeploy the checkpoint service using the standard pipeline, which requires a signed release manifest. The deploy key used to sign that manifest is below.

rollout seal: bky9_PeXH1fTLY

### Deploy Step 2: Configure FabriKit

FabriKit is our test-data factory library; it seeds deterministic fixtures before integration runs. New team members should set FABRIKIT_SEED=2048 and FABRIKIT_LOCALE=en in the service env file so generated records match the shared snapshots. The factory also pushes anonymized fixtures to the shared cache, which requires an upload credential set on the following line.

env line for fafof-fahag: LEDGER_TOKEN5=f8790

Release runbook — Quillhaven partner drop. Once the nightly build for Lanternfox 4.2 passes smoke tests, zip the export bundle and push it to the Quillhaven SFTP drop before 06:00 their time, or their ingest job will skip us for the day. Marta usually pings their ops channel as a courtesy. The drop host only accepts the deploy key we rotated last sprint, shown below.

deploy key for yajeg-hahog: bky3_BZq